Why Knowing Your Exact Fish Tank Volume Matters
Numerous enthusiasts make the error of counting on the small size printed on a tank's packaging-- such as a "50-gallon breeder"-- without considering displacement and precise geometry. Understanding the precise water volume in gallons is necessary for a number of factors:
- Medication Dosage: Overdosing can be fatal to fish, while underdosing renders medications ineffective against illness like Ich or fin rot.
- Stocking Limits: The timeless "one inch of fish per gallon" guideline (though out-of-date and nuanced) relies completely on knowing real gallon capacity.
- Water Conditioner and Salt: Water treatments need precise dosing per gallon to neutralize heavy metals and chlorine safely.
- Filter and Heater Sizing: Equipment is ranked by gallon capability. An underpowered filter in a larger-than-expected tank will result in bad water quality.
Standard Fish Tank Shapes and Their Formulas
Calculating water volume depends greatly on the geometry of the tank. While a standard rectangle-shaped Calculate Aquarium Capacity is simple, bow-fronts, cubes, and hex tanks require particular mathematical formulas.
1. Rectangular Aquariums
The most typical and easiest to determine.
- Formula: ₤ text Length times text Width times text Height div 231 = text Gallons ₤
- (Note: 231 cubic inches equals one liquid United States gallon).
2. Cylindrical (Circular) Tanks
Popular for contemporary, minimalist aquascapes.
- Formula: ₤ pi times text Radius ^ 2 times text Height div 231 = text Gallons ₤
- (Radius is half of the tank's size).
3. Bow-Front Aquariums
These tanks feature a curved front panel, making manual computation tricky.
- Formula: ₤ text Length times ( text Width + text Optimum Depth) div 2 times text Height div 231 = text Gallons ₤

When utilizing an online digital calculator, the procedure is streamlined, however accuracy depends entirely on the numbers gotten in. Follow these actions to get the most accurate reading:
- Measure the Interior Dimensions: Always determine the inside of the tank instead of the outside. Measuring the outside includes the thickness of the glass or acrylic, which can add a gallon or 2 of mistake to bigger tanks.
- Measure Water Height, Not Tank Height: Do not measure from the bottom glass to the very leading rim. Step from the bottom substrate line (or where the water level really sits) to the regular water surface line. Water displacement from decors and filters will also minimize this.
- Select the Tank Shape: Choose the correct category (rectangular, bow-front, cylinder, or cube) on the calculator user interface.
- Input the Measurements: Enter the measurements in inches (or centimeters, if the calculator allows metric conversion) to discover the result in gallons.
Aspects That Reduce True Water Volume
Many novices assume that a 50-gallon tank holds 50 gallons of water. In reality, real water volume is generally 10% to 15% lower than the nominal tank size due to physical displacement.
Several common aspects displace water:
- Substrate: Gravel, sand, and aqua-soil take up significant space at the bottom of the tank. A 2-inch layer of gravel in a 55-gallon tank can displace a number of gallons of water.
- Hardscape: Large driftwood pieces, lava rocks, and dragon stones displace volume based on their mass and displacement volume.
- Backgrounds and 3D Inserts: Foam background walls glued to the back glass can take considerable swimming space and water capability.
- Filter Equipment: Internal power filters, cylinder filter intake/output tubes, and heating unit units use up small quantities of volume.
Vital Checklist for Accurate Volume Calculation
Before dosing medications or stocking a freshly cycled aquarium, gone through this quick examination list to verify calculations:
- Measured dimensions from the within of the glass.
- Measured the water height, representing the space on top left empty (headspace).
- Converted all measurements to the very same unit (ideally inches for United States Gallons).
- Accounted for displacement brought on by heavy aquascaping, rocks, and substrate.
- Double-checked computations utilizing a secondary formula or digital calculator.
